# Quillstone Environments

Quillstone runs in dev, staging, and prod. All three support hot-reloading of configuration: edits to the config store propagate within roughly thirty seconds, no restart required. Feature flags reload the same way. If a change doesn't take effect, check the reload log before escalating. Schema-invalid values are rejected and the last good config stays active. The current values watched by the hot-reloader are listed below.

deployment values, kajep-kageg:
[praix]
host = praix.paliqcorp.corp
user = praix_svc
database = praix_prod

Subject: Handover — LedgerLift tax cache

Hey, passing the baton. The tax-rate lookup cache refreshes nightly; if it goes stale, invoices in the Ostermere region show zero tax — page-worthy. Refresh manually with `ledgerlift cache:warm` and redeploy. The deploy gateway wants signed pushes, so you'll need the deploy key below.

rollout seal: bky4_x7Gc

Ticket: Vault lockout blocking FeedProof validator release

While preparing the 2.4 release of FeedProof, our podcast feed validator, the signing vault locked itself after the scheduled key rotation failed midway. Build artifacts are ready and reviewed, but release signing cannot proceed. I've confirmed the rotation log shows a clean pre-failure state, so a manual unseal is safe. Please unseal using the recovery passphrase below.

vault phrase of kahap-bagug = novvan-istir-holael-oliwyn-fraath-tamius-zorael-fenok-oliir